Plastic extrusion molding is a widely used manufacturing process that shapes plastic materials into a variety of forms. This technique is essential for producing consistent and high-quality products, from simple rods to complex profiles. The first step in plastic extrusion molding involves selecting the right type of plastic. The properties of the material can significantly affect the quality of the final product. Common materials used in extrusion include PVC, ABS, and polycarbonate, each offering unique characteristics. A thorough understanding of material properties, such as melting point, viscosity, and thermal stability, will help in making the appropriate choice.
Once you've selected your material, the next step is preparing the extrusion equipment. This includes ensuring that the extruder is clean and that the die is properly installed and calibrated. The temperature settings should be adjusted according to the specific material being used, with attention paid to both the barrel and the die. Keeping equipment well-maintained not only enhances production efficiency but also contributes to the overall quality of the molded plastic.
Throughout the extrusion process, continuously monitoring key parameters is essential. These include temperature, pressure, and speed. Maintaining stable conditions helps in achieving uniform flow and ensures that the material is extruded without defects. Any fluctuations in these parameters can lead to issues such as warping or inconsistent thickness, so leveraging advanced sensors and digital monitoring tools can be beneficial.
A rigorous quality control process should be established to inspect the extruded products. This includes dimensional checks and visual inspections to identify any defects. Implementing statistical quality control methods can provide insights into the production process and help identify trends that need to be addressed. By addressing issues proactively, businesses can reduce waste and improve the overall quality of their outputs.
After the extrusion process, various post-processing techniques can enhance the final product's quality. This may include cutting, trimming, or surface finishing to ensure that the product meets specifications and customer expectations. Additionally, applying coatings or treatments can improve appearance and functionality, making the final product more appealing in the market.
